maintenance doors, also known as access doors or service doors, are openings in walls or ceilings that allow entry to spaces that require regular maintenance or inspection. These doors are designed to provide easy access to mechanical, electrical, plumbing, or other systems that need to be serviced periodically. Unlike regular doors, maintenance doors are typically unobtrusive and are often hidden from view to maintain the aesthetic appeal of the space.
One of the primary functions of maintenance doors is to provide access for maintenance personnel to carry out routine inspections, repairs, and upgrades to building systems. Whether it be HVAC units, plumbing lines, or electrical panels, these doors allow technicians to access critical equipment without disrupting the daily operations of the building. This not only saves time and resources but also ensures that the systems are properly maintained to prevent breakdowns and costly repairs.
In addition to facilitating maintenance activities, maintenance doors also play a crucial role in ensuring the safety of a building and its occupants. By providing easy access to essential systems, such as fire suppression equipment or emergency lighting, these doors enable quick responses in the event of an emergency. For example, firefighters may need to access a mechanical room to shut off gas lines or ventilation systems during a fire, and maintenance doors provide the necessary access points for such critical tasks.
Furthermore, maintenance doors can also improve the energy efficiency of a building by allowing easy access to HVAC units for regular maintenance and filter changes. Properly maintained heating and cooling systems can help reduce energy consumption and prolong the lifespan of equipment, saving money on utility bills and preventing costly repairs down the line. By ensuring that maintenance doors are readily accessible and well-maintained, building owners can help maximize the efficiency and performance of their HVAC systems.
When it comes to selecting maintenance doors for a building, there are several factors to consider. The type of door required will depend on the size and location of the access point, as well as the frequency of maintenance activities. For example, larger equipment rooms may require double doors or sliding panels to accommodate bulky machinery, while smaller electrical enclosures may only need a single access panel.
It is essential to choose maintenance doors that are durable, secure, and easy to operate, as they will be regularly used by maintenance personnel. Doors made from high-quality materials, such as steel or aluminum, are recommended for areas with heavy foot traffic or extreme environmental conditions. Additionally, doors with built-in locks or security features can help prevent unauthorized access to sensitive equipment or systems.
Proper maintenance of maintenance doors is also crucial to ensure their longevity and functionality. Regular inspections should be conducted to check for any signs of wear and tear, such as rust, corrosion, or loose hinges. Lubricating moving parts, such as hinges and latches, can help prevent squeaking and ensure smooth operation. If any damage is detected, prompt repairs should be made to prevent further deterioration and maintain the integrity of the door.
